CAUTIONARY NOTICES
• The XPD is designed for indoor use only in a controlled environment away from excess moisture, tempera-
ture extremes, conducve contaminants, dust or direct sunlight.
• Do not connect the XPD to an ungrounded outlet or extension cords or adapters that eliminate the connec-
on to ground.
• The power requirement for each piece of equipment connected to the XPD must not exceed the individual
outlet’s load rang.
• The total power requirements for equipment connected to the XPD must not exceed the maximum load rat-
ing.
• Do not drill into or aempt to open any part of the XPD housing. There are no user-serviceable parts
inside.
• Do not aempt to modify the XPD, including the input plugs and power cables.
• Do not aempt to use the XPD if any part of it becomes damaged.
• Do not aempt to mount the XPD to an insecure or unstable surface.
• Never aempt to install electrical equipment during a thunderstorm.
• Install the XPD away from; objects which give o excessive heat and areas, which are excessively wet.
• This PDU supports electronic equipment in oces, telecommunicaons, process control, medical,
• security, and IT applicaons.
• To reduce the risk of re, connect only to a branch circuit with over current protecon in accordance with
the Naonal Electric Code, ANSI/NFPA 70(3KVA)
• To reduce the risk of electrical shock with the installaon of this PDU equipment and the connected equip-
ment, the user must ensure that the combined sum of the AC leakage current does not exceed 3.5mA.
• Rack Mount Instrucons - The following or similar rack-mount instrucons are included with the installaon
instrucons:
A) Elevated Operang Ambient - If installed in a closed or mul-unit rack assembly, the operang ambient tem-
perature of the rack environment may be greater than room ambient. Therefore, consideraon should be given
to installing the equipment in an environment compable with the maximum ambient temperature (Tma) speci-
ed by the manufacturer.
B) Reduced Air Flow - Installaon of the equipment in a rack should be such that the amount of air ow required
for safe operaon of the equipment is not compromised.
C) Mechanical Loading - Mounng of the equipment in the rack should be such that a hazardous condion is not
achieved due to uneven mechanical loading.
D) Circuit Overloading - Consideraon should be given to the connecon of the equipment to the supply circuit
and the eect that overloading of the circuits might have on overcurrent protecon and supply wiring. Appropri-
ate consideraon of equipment nameplate rangs should be used when addressing this concern.
E) Reliable Earthing - Reliable earthing of rack-mounted equipment should be maintained. Parcular aenon
should be given to supply connecons other than direct connecons to the branch circuit (e.g. use of power
strips).

Environmental
Operang Temperature (Max) : 0 to 50 degrees C (+32 to +122 degrees F)
Operang Elevaon : 0 to 3,000m (0 to +10,000 )
Operang and Storage Relave Humidity: 0 - 90%, non-condensing
Storage Temperature : 0 to 65 degrees C (+32 to +149 degrees F)
Storage Elevaon : 0 to 15,000m (0 to +50,000 )

Installaon
Installaon Conguraon: The XPD supports horizontal 1U rack mount and vercal 1U rack mount installaon.
Horizontal Installaon (1U)
1. Aach the two XPD horizontal mounng brackets (included) on each end of the XPD using four retaining
screws (included) (Fig. 1).
2. Install the XPD in a suitable horizontal locaon in the rack rail using four user-supplied mounng screws.
3. Connect the grounding lug of the XPD to a ground point on the rack rail.

Connecng
1. Connecng the Equipment
Plug the equipment into the output receptacles on the XPD. Do not uses, adapter plugs or surge strips on the
output of the XPD.
Ensure that the load does not exceed the maximum output rang of the XPD.
(refer to the informaon label on the XPD or the Electrical Specicaons
in this Quick Guide).
2. Connecng to the Power source
Aach the input plug of the XPD to a grounded outlet. Verify that the voltage and frequency rangs match that
of the ulity power, and then connect the AC Input power cord into a three- pole, three-wire easily accessible
dedicated (recommended) grounded receptacle or one that does not share a circuit with a heavy electrical load
only.
Cauon
1. Do not install this device if there is not at least 10 meters (30 feet) or more of wire between the electrical out-
let and the electrical service panel.
2. This device features an internal protecon that will disconnect the surge protecve component at the end of
its useful life but will maintain power to the load – now unprotected. If this situaon is undesirable for the appli-
caon, follow the manufacturer’s instrucons for replacing the device.
3. Indicator light illuminates means that AC Power goes to socket outlets and Surge Protecon funcon works.
Do not use this device when Indicator light OFF.
